This is a pretty listenable mini-album, although I'm not quite sure why. Kaori's vocal deliveries range from passable to poor, and her voice is nothing particularly unique. You could grab a handful of similar singers out of any collection of mildly popular j-pop acts. The melodies and arrangements found on this disc are also, mostly, quite standard pop fair, and could be mooshed in with any number of idol acts seamlessly. The production style is the standard I've Sound sound, and I can turn to any number of I've girls for it. Put all these things together, and the outcome is actually fairly pleasant. It does feel like a pretty safe and mild album, especially from I've Sound, but some tracks manage to be quite nice (Spyglass, Kono Sora no Shita de), while others hit on awkward (Chasse, which is cutesy and sounds like a child taking a stomping stroll to squash bugs).
So really, the parts are typical and fairly standard. Which leads me to wonder: Why should I be interested in Kaori Utatsuki? I don't know. But this is only a first try. She'll just have to prove herself.
